A client with schizophrenia says, “I’m away for the day ... but don’t think we should play or do we have feet of clay?” Which alteration in the client’s speech does the nurse document? 
A.	Neologism 
B.	Word salad 
C.	Clang association Correct 
D.	Associative looseness 
Rationale: Clang association is the meaningless rhyming of words in which the rhyming is more important than the context of the words.
